20 / 222 page ![]() MCP19111 DS22331A-page 20 2013 Microchip Technology Inc. 3.10.3 OUTPUT POWER GOOD The output voltage measured between the +VSEN and -VSEN pins can be monitored by the internal ADC. In firmware, when this ADC reading matches a user defined power good value, a GPIO can be toggled to indicate the system output voltage is within a specified range. Delays, hysteresis and time out values can all be configured in firmware. 3.10.4 OUTPUT VOLTAGE SOFT-START During start-up, soft start of the output voltage is accomplished in firmware. By using one of the internal timers and incrementing the OVCCON or OVFCON register on a timer overflow, very long soft start times can be achieved. 3.10.5 OUTPUT VOLTAGE TRACKING The MCP19111 can be configured to track another voltage signal at start-up or shutdown. The ADC is configured to read a GPIO that has the desired tracking voltage applied to it. The firmware then handles the tracking of the internal output voltage reference to this ADC reading. 3.10.6 MULTI-PHASE SYSTEM In a multi-phase system the output of each converter is connected together. There is one master device that sets the system switching frequency and provides each slave device with an error signal, in order to regulate the output to the same value. The MCP19111 can be configured as a multi-phase master or slave by the setting of the MLTPH<2:0> bits in the BUFFCON register (Register 8-2). When set as a multi-phase master device, the internal switching fre- quency clock is connected to GPA1 and the output of the error amplifier is connected to GPB1. The GPIOs need to be configured as outputs. When set as a multi-phase slave device, the GPA1 pin is configured as the CLKPIN function. The switching frequency clock from the master device must be connected to GPA1. The slave device will synchronize its internal switching frequency clock to the master clock. Phase shift can be applied by setting the PWMPHL register of the slave device. The slave GPB1 pin is configured as the error signal input pin (EAPIN). The master error amplifier output must be connected to GPB1. Gain can be added to the master error amplifier output signal by the SLVGNCON register setting (Register 6-8). The slave device will use this master error signal to regulate the output voltage. When set as a slave device, GPA1 and GPB1 need to be configured as inputs. Refer to Section 26.1 “Standard Pulse- Width Modulation (PWM) Mode” for additional information . 3.10.7 MULTIPLE OUTPUT SYSTEM In a multiple output system, the switching frequency of each converter should be synchronized to a master clock to prevent beat frequencies from developing. Phase shift is often added to the master clock to help smooth the system input current. The MCP19111 has the ability to function as a multiple output master or slave by setting the appropriate MLTPH<2:0> bits in the BUFFCON register (Register 8-2). When configured as a multiple output master, the GPA1 pin is set as the CLKPIN output function. The internal switching frequency clock is applied to this pin and is to be connected to the GPA1 pin of the slave units. When configured as a multiple output slave, the GPA1 pin is set as the CLKPIN input function. The switching frequency clock of the master device is connected to this pin. Phase shift can be applied by appropriately setting the PWMPHL register of the slave device. Refer to Section 26.1 “Standard Pulse-Width Modulation (PWM) Mode”. 3.10.8 SYSTEM BENCH TESTING The MCP19111 is a highly integrated controller. To facilitate system prototyping, various internal signals can be measured by configuring the MCP19111 in bench test mode. To accomplish this, the ATSTCON<BNCHEN> bit is set. This configures GPA0 as the ANALOG_TEST feature. The signals measured on GPA0 are controlled by the ASEL<4:0> bits of the BUFFCON register. See Section 8.0 “System Bench Testing” for more information. Note 1: The ALT_CLKPIN can also be used by setting the APFCON<CLKSEL> bit.
